Try this sometime... next time you start feeling nervous your fuel level... stop and fill a small container with gas instead of your bike... keep it with you until you run out... write down the mileage - that's how far you can travel before you're pushing... pour the container of gas into your fuel tank and head to a service station... you spend a lot of time pumping gas the way you do it. Oh yeh... do not trust your gas gauge to be accurate... it never will be... in fact, I removed mine and put a cup holder in.
